How Do You Remove Duplicates From An Array In C++?

How do I remove duplicate characters in a string?

Java program to delete duplicate characters from a given StringConvert it into a character array.Try to insert elements of the above-created array into a hash set using add method.If the addition is successful this method returns true.Since Set doesn’t allow duplicate elements this method returns 0 when you try to insert duplicate elements.Print those elements..

How do you find duplicate characters in a string?

How do you find duplicate characters in a string?import java.util.HashMap;import java.util.Map;import java.util.Set;public class DuplicateCharFinder {public void findIt(String str) {Map baseMap = new HashMap();char[] charArray = str.toCharArray();More items…

Can ArrayList have duplicates?

4) Duplicates: ArrayList allows duplicate elements but HashMap doesn’t allow duplicate keys (It does allow duplicate values). 5) Nulls: ArrayList can have any number of null elements. … In HashMap the elements is being fetched by specifying the corresponding key.

How do you delete an array in C++?

1. Deleting Array Objects: We delete an array using [] brackets.filter_none. // Program to illustrate deletion of array. #include using namespace std; int main() … chevron_right. filter_none.filter_none. // C++ program to deleting. // NULLL pointer. #include … chevron_right. filter_none.

How do I remove duplicates from an array Python?

Removing duplicate items from a list is a common operation in Python. There is no official method that should be used to remove duplicates from a list, but the most common approaches are to use the dictionary fromkeys() function or convert your data into a set.

How does HashMap find duplicates in array?

We store the elements of input array as keys of the HashMap and their occurrences as values of the HashMap. If the value of any key is more than one (>1) then that key is duplicate element. Using this method, you can also find the number of occurrences of duplicates.

How do you remove duplicates in C++?

Remove duplicate elements in an Array using STL in C++ This can be done using set in standard template library. Set type variable in STL automatically removes duplicating element when we store the element in it.

How do you remove all elements from an array in C++?

Delete elements in C++ STL listUsing list::erase(): The purpose of this function is to remove the elements from list. Single or multiple contiguous elements in range can be removed using this function. … Using list::pop_front() and list::pop_back(): pop_back() : This function removes the last element from the list. … Using remove() and remove_if():

How do you find duplicates in arrays?

AlgorithmDeclare and initialize an array.Duplicate elements can be found using two loops. The outer loop will iterate through the array from 0 to length of the array. The outer loop will select an element. … If a match is found which means the duplicate element is found then, display the element.

Does list allow duplicates in Python?

Sets require your items to be unique and immutable. Duplicates are not allowed in sets, while lists allow for duplicates and are mutable.

Can sets have duplicates Python?

A set is an unordered collection of items. Every set element is unique (no duplicates) and must be immutable (cannot be changed). However, a set itself is mutable.

How do you remove duplicates in Java?

How to remove duplicate words from String using Java 8?package com. javacodeexamples. … import java. util. … import java. util. … public class RemoveDuplicateWordsStringExample {public static void main(String[] args) {String str =”The first second was alright but the second second was tough.”;str = Arrays. stream( str.More items…•

How do I find duplicates in a list?

To do so:Select the range of cells you wish to test. … On Excel’s Home tab, choose Conditional Formatting, Highlight Cells Rules, and then Duplicate Values.Click OK within the Duplicate Values dialog box to identify the duplicate values.Duplicate values in the list will now be identified.

How do you remove duplicates from an array?

Algorithm to remove duplicate elements in an array (sorted array)Input the number of elements of the array.Input the array elements.Repeat from i = 1 to n.- if (arr[i] != arr[i+1])- temp[j++] = arr[i]- temp[j++] = arr[n-1]Repeat from i = 1 to j.- arr[i] = temp[i]More items…•

Does tuple allow duplicates in Python?

31.2 Python Collection Types Tuples A Tuple represents a collection of objects that are ordered and immutable (cannot be modified). Tuples allow duplicate members and are indexed. Lists Lists hold a collection of objects that are ordered and mutable (changeable), they are indexed and allow duplicate members.

How do I remove a specific element from an array?

You can remove elements from the end of an array using pop, from the beginning using shift, or from the middle using splice. The JavaScript Array filter method to create a new array with desired items, a more advanced way to remove unwanted elements.

How do you remove the last element of an array in C++?

You cannot remove the last element of an array in C++ because the array has fixed size….This is the usual method for extending or shrinking an array.Copy to a new array with a for-loop or recursive statement, excluding the last element.Delete old array.Reference new array.

How do you remove duplicates from an array in C++?

The program output is shown below.#includeint A[10], B[10], n, i, j, k = 0;cout << "Enter size of array : ";cin >> n;cout << "Enter elements of array : ";for (i = 0; i < n; i++)cin >> A[i];for (i = 0; i < n; i++)More items...